If you’re looking for a DIY face mask to reduce tanning and brighten the skin, the following natural ingredients can help. These masks can lighten sun-tanned areas, remove dead skin cells, and restore your skin’s natural glow. Here are some effective DIY face masks for tanning:

1. Lemon and Honey Mask

  • Benefits: Lemon has natural bleaching properties that can help lighten tan, while honey moisturizes and soothes the skin.
  • Ingredients:
    • 1 tablespoon of lemon juice
    • 1 tablespoon of honey
  • How to Use:
    1. Mix the lemon juice and honey to form a smooth paste.
    2. Apply it to your face and leave it on for 15-20 minutes.
    3. Rinse off with lukewarm water.
    • Frequency: Use 2-3 times a week. Be sure to avoid direct sun exposure after using lemon juice.

2. Yogurt and Turmeric Mask

  • Benefits: Yogurt contains lactic acid, which gently exfoliates and removes tan, while turmeric brightens the skin and reduces pigmentation.
  • Ingredients:
    • 2 tablespoons of plain yogurt
    • ½ teaspoon of turmeric powder
  • How to Use:
    1. Mix yogurt and turmeric to make a paste.
    2. Apply it to your face and leave it on for 15-20 minutes.
    3. Rinse with cold water.
    • Frequency: Use 2-3 times a week for best results.

3. Tomato and Gram Flour (Besan) DIY Face Mask

  • Benefits: Tomatoes are rich in antioxidants and have natural bleaching properties, while gram flour helps exfoliate and remove dead skin cells.
  • Ingredients:
    • 1 tablespoon of tomato juice
    • 2 tablespoons of gram flour (besan)
    • A pinch of turmeric
  • How to Use:
    1. Mix all the ingredients to form a smooth paste.
    2. Apply it to your face and leave it on for 15-20 minutes.
    3. Gently scrub off the mask with water.
    • Frequency: Use 2-3 times a week to reduce tanning.

4. Cucumber and Aloe Vera DIY Face Mask

  • Benefits: Cucumber cools and soothes sunburned skin, while aloe vera is a powerful hydrating agent that reduces tan and repairs the skin.
  • Ingredients:
    • 2 tablespoons of cucumber juice
    • 2 tablespoons of aloe vera gel
  • How to Use:
    1. Mix cucumber juice and aloe vera gel to form a cooling mask.
    2. Apply it to your face and let it sit for 15-20 minutes.
    3. Rinse off with water.
    • Frequency: Use daily or as often as needed, especially if you have sensitive skin.

5. Papaya and Honey Mask

  • Benefits: Papaya contains papain, an enzyme that exfoliates and removes dead skin cells, helping to lighten the tan. Honey adds moisture and soothes the skin.
  • Ingredients:
    • 1/2 cup of mashed ripe papaya
    • 1 tablespoon of honey
  • How to Use:
    1. Mash the papaya and mix it with honey.
    2. Apply the mixture to your face and leave it on for 20 minutes.
    3. Rinse with cold water.
    • Frequency: Use 2-3 times a week for glowing, tan-free skin.

6. Oatmeal and Buttermilk Mask

  • Benefits: Oatmeal is a gentle exfoliant, and buttermilk contains lactic acid that helps lighten tanned skin while soothing sunburn.
  • Ingredients:
    • 2 tablespoons of oatmeal
    • 3 tablespoons of buttermilk
  • How to Use:
    1. Soak the oatmeal in buttermilk for 10 minutes.
    2. Apply the mixture to your face, scrubbing gently in circular motions.
    3. Leave it on for 15-20 minutes, then rinse with water.
    • Frequency: Use once or twice a week.
